Unlocking Moringa's Magic: A Comprehensive Review
Moringa oleifera, often hailed as the nutritional tree, has been utilized for centuries for its remarkable health benefits. This exceptional plant boasts a wealth of vitamins, delivering a powerful punch to support overall well-being. From traditional practices to modern scientific research, the efficacy of moringa continues to enchant. Journey i